Musical polymath Barnaby Keen's single "Lay Our Cards” is to be his first release on South London label Plum Cuts.
Produced in collaboration with Oli Barton-Wood (Nilufer Yanya, Mellah), it marks a departure from his regular groups Electric Jalaba (STRUT Records), Flying Ibex and acclaimed collaboration with Portugese artist Benjamin, showing a softer more considered side to his songwriting with laid back grooves and contemplative lyrics. Being born out of the same musical sphere that has produced talents Kae Tempest, Yusef Dayes and Mellah, Barnaby will certainly follow closely in their wake.
